Key Insights
The global Wireless Humidity Sensor market is poised for substantial growth, projected to reach USD 3.44 billion in 2025, and is expected to expand at a robust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 6.2% during the forecast period of 2025-2033. This upward trajectory is fueled by an increasing demand across residential, commercial, and industrial sectors, driven by the growing need for precise environmental monitoring and control. The proliferation of the Internet of Things (IoT) and smart building technologies is a significant catalyst, enabling remote data access and automated responses to environmental fluctuations. Furthermore, rising awareness regarding the impact of humidity on product quality, human health, and infrastructure integrity is compelling businesses and individuals to invest in advanced humidity sensing solutions. The market is also benefiting from technological advancements in sensor accuracy, miniaturization, and power efficiency, making wireless humidity sensors more accessible and versatile for a wider range of applications.

Wireless Humidity Sensor Product Analysis
Wireless humidity sensors are evolving rapidly, offering enhanced accuracy, miniaturization, and improved connectivity for diverse applications. Innovations focus on longer battery life, wider operating temperature ranges, and seamless integration into IoT platforms. Key product advancements include the development of highly sensitive capacitive and resistive sensors, as well as optical and thermal conductivity-based technologies for specialized needs. The competitive advantage lies in offering robust, cost-effective solutions that provide real-time data for better decision-making in residential, commercial, and industrial settings. Applications range from optimizing HVAC systems for energy savings and comfort in homes and offices to ensuring critical environmental conditions in pharmaceutical manufacturing and data centers, preventing spoilage in warehouses, and supporting precision agriculture.
